The idea of LEGO CAD is quite amazing. CAD refers to Computer Aided Design. In terms of designing Lego structures, machines, and objects on your computer, it is very possible using several software applications created by both LEGO and third parties.
LEGO's own software
, Lego Digital Designer is no longer being supported. Yes, it could still be downloaded (with errors until you enter offline mode). If you want to avoid errors etc.. we recommend
LEO CAD (open source alternative)